Choosing between Mews PMS by Mews and Persefone by Persefone hinges on your hotel’s operational needs and growth ambitions. Mews excels in automation, integrations, and user experience, while Persefone offers a more traditional, all-in-one platform with a strong Italian legacy. Both aim to streamline hotel operations, but their approaches and maturity levels differ significantly. Which solution aligns best with your hotel’s current stage and future plans?
Mews is a cloud-native property management system with a high user rating of 4.62/5 from 758 reviews, emphasizing ease of use, automation, and extensive integrations. Persefone, with over 17 years in the market and more than 3,000 hotels served, is a European-based system renowned for its comprehensive suite of features and reliable support but has no publicly available recent reviews or ratings. Does your hotel prioritize innovative technology and a broad ecosystem, or do you prefer a proven, integrated package with long-term stability?
Mews’s recent reviews reflect a modern, flexible platform favored by boutique, hostel, and city-center hotels, whereas Persefone’s reputation is built on stability and a full set of features, mostly appreciated by Italian hotels. Are you seeking a cutting-edge, scalable system or a tried-and-true solution with deep local expertise?
If your hotel needs a flexible, cloud-based PMS with a focus on automation, integrations, and guest experience, go with Mews. Its recent review count and ratings demonstrate active adoption and ongoing improvements, making it ideal for hotels aiming to modernize operations quickly.
If your hotel prefers a traditional, all-in-one software suite with extensive features designed for the Italian market, Persefone might suit your needs better. Its long-standing presence and integrated approach appeal to hotels that value stability and a comprehensive management tool, especially if they operate primarily in Italy or similar markets.
For fast-growing hotels seeking agility, Mews’s open API, marketplace, and rapid innovation are unmatched. Conversely, if you prioritize a fully integrated, regional solution with a history of serving thousands of hotels, Persefone’s deep feature set and support may be advantageous.
Mews boasts a user rating of 4.7/5 for ease of use across 679 reviews, with many hoteliers praising its intuitive interface, quick onboarding, and modern design. Recent feedback highlights its simple reservation dashboards, guest messaging, and remote access, supporting staff of all tech skill levels.
Persefone has not publicly shared a recent ease-of-use rating or detailed user feedback, but its long history suggests a traditional, feature-rich interface that may require more training and adaptation, especially for staff unfamiliar with legacy systems. Is your team ready for a modern, user-centric platform or better served by a familiar, all-in-one interface?
Edge: Mews.
Mews offers over 49 features exclusive to its platform, including multi-lingual, multi-currency support, revenue management, guest CRM, online check-in, digital registration, automated night audit, guest app, real-time reporting, shift planning, and more. Its broad suite is designed to improve operational agility and guest engagement.
Persefone, on the other hand, consolidates all functionalities into a single web solution, but specific feature counts or unique functionalities are not publicly detailed. It likely includes core hotel management features but lacks the extensive optional modules and customization that Mews provides.
Edge: Mews.
Mews maintains a support rating of 4.27/5 from 758 recent reviews, with users often citing quick, helpful responses and effective onboarding, though some report occasional bugs that are resolved swiftly. Its large global team offers 24/7 support, aiding in onboarding and ongoing troubleshooting.
Persefone emphasizes serious technical support, stemming from its 17-year history, but it has no recent review data to gauge current support quality. Its support is reputed to be reliable, especially within Italy, but recent user feedback is unavailable for comparison.
Edge: Mews.
Mews's ecosystem surpasses 336 verified partners, including channel managers, payment providers, CRMs, and more, with a vibrant marketplace enabling rapid integration of third-party tools. This vast network allows your hotel to customize and expand its tech stack with ease.
Persefone offers a fully integrated solution but has no publicly available data on third-party integrations or a marketplace. Its ecosystem is likely more closed, emphasizing stability over flexibility.
Edge: Mews.
Mews is rated 4.62/5 by 758 reviews, with recent feedback emphasizing its user-friendliness, automation, and excellent support, especially among boutique and city hotels. The high review count and recency indicate a vibrant, satisfied user base.
Persefone has no recent reviews or ratings published publicly, limiting the ability to gauge user satisfaction today. Its longstanding reputation suggests reliability, but it lacks current data to compare.
Edge: Mews.
Mews’s pricing starts at $900 per month, reflecting its enterprise-level automation and extensive features, with no free tier or trial. Persefone’s pricing is listed at $200 per month, offering a more affordable but less detailed view of its pricing structure, which may include custom quotes for larger hotels.
While Mews’s higher price is justified by its advanced capabilities, Persefone’s lower cost could appeal to smaller or budget-conscious properties. Do your operational needs justify the investment in Mews’s wider capabilities?

De HT Score is een samengestelde ranglijst die 4 criteriagroepen en meer dan tien variabelen meeweegt om hoteliers te helpen hoteltechnologieproducten objectief te vergelijken. Mews heeft een HT Score van 100 en Persefone heeft 0. Zo wordt de score berekend.

Hoe hoog beoordelen gebruikers dit product? Beoordelingsscore, reviewvolume, marktaandeel, reviewdiepte, reviewrecentheid, succesverhalen ▾ De zwaarst gewogen factor. Analyseert gemiddelde tevredenheidsbeoordelingen (waarschijnlijkheid om aan te bevelen, gebruiksgemak, ondersteuning, ROI), het totale aantal reviews ten opzichte van categoriegenoten, recentheid van reviews (minimaal 20 reviews in de afgelopen 6 maanden) en marktaandeel over unieke hotelklanten om selectiebias te detecteren. |
